Hotel Cipriani Headlines Crystal Cruises’ Expanded Portfolio Of European Pre- And Post-Cruise Hotel Options

Venice’s venerable Hotel Cipriani and Hotel Danieli, Istanbul’s Ritz-Carlton and Athens’ Hotel Grande Bretagne are the grand new additions to Crystal Cruises’ 2007 European Crystal Adventures Hotel Program. The four new hotels join an expanded collection of Europe’s most prestigious properties – 15 in all – offering savvy travelers luxurious options to extend their Crystal vacations with a pre- or post-cruise hotel stay.

Crystal Symphony and Crystal Serenity offer 29 European itineraries from April through November. In several of the cruise departure and arrival cities, guests may choose from more than one hotel including:

  • Venice, Italy: Hotel Cipriani (new) Hotel Danieli (new); Hotel Bauer; Il Palazzo at the Hotel Bauer
  • Monte Carlo, Monaco: Hotel Hermitage
  • Rome, Italy: Grand Hotel Parco Dei Principi; St. Regis Grand
  • Lisbon, Portugal: Four Seasons Hotel Ritz Lisbon
  • Istanbul, Turkey: The Ritz-Carlton, Istanbul (new)
  • Stockholm, Sweden: The Grand Hotel
  • London, England: Renaissance Chancery Court London; The Berkeley Hotel
  • Copenhagen, Denmark: Copenhagen Marriott
  • Athens, Greece: Hotel Grande Bretagne (new); Athenaeum InterContinental Hotel

The Crystal Adventures Hotel Program is offered on each cruise in all nine departure and arrival cities, which include Athens, Copenhagen, Istanbul, Lisbon, London, Monte Carlo, Rome, Stockholm and Venice. For the two Crystal Serenity cruises that end or begin in Toulon, France, guests may extend their travels to Monte Carlo or Venice.
